Travelling waves for diffusive and strongly competitive systems: relative motility and invasion speed

Résumé

Our interest here is to find the invader in a two species, diffusive and competitive Lotka Volterra system in the particular case of travelling wave solutions. We investigate the role of diffusion in homogeneous domains. We might expect a priori two dierent cases: strong interspecific competition and weak interspecific competition. In this paper, we study the first one and obtain a clear conclusion: the invading species is, up to a fixed multiplicative constant, the more diffusive one.
